What is a solution?

Back

A solution is a homogeneous mixture where one substance (the solute) is dissolved in another (the solvent).

What is a mixture?

Back

A mixture is a combination of two or more substances where each retains its own properties and can be separated by physical means.

What is the difference between a solution and a mixture?

Back

A solution is a type of mixture that is homogeneous, meaning the components are evenly distributed, while a mixture can be heterogeneous, where the components are not uniformly distributed.

What is the conservation of mass?

Back

The conservation of mass is a principle stating that matter cannot be created or destroyed in an isolated system, only transformed from one form to another.

What is combustion?

Back

Combustion is a chemical reaction that occurs when a substance reacts with oxygen, producing heat and light.
